- The distance between Minna, Nigeria and Red Deer, Ab, Canada is approximately 11,123 km or 6,912 mi.
- To reach Minna in this distance one would set out from Red Deer, Ab bearing 59.7°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Minna bearing 147.5° or SSE .
- Minna has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Red Deer, Ab has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
- Minna is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Red Deer, Ab is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 24.7 °C (44.5°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 24 °C (43.2°F) less in Minna.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 739.5 mm (29.1 in) more which is equivalent to 739.5 l/m² (18.15 US gal/ft²) or 7,395,000 l/ha (790,575 US gal/ac) more. About 2 4/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 35.8° higher in Minna than in Red Deer, Ab.
